Yükseköğretimde Hizmet Kalitesi ve Öğrenci Memnuniyeti: Görsel Haritalama Tekniği ile Bibliyometrik Analiz

Yükseköğretimde hizmet kalitesi araştırmaları gelişen teknoloji, değişen çevre ve öğrenci profili nedeniyle sürekliliğini korumaya devam etmektedir. Öğrenci memnuniyeti, yükseköğretim kurumlarının en önemli hedeflerinden biri haline gelmiştir. Bu nedenle çalışma, dünya genelinde yükseköğretimde hizmet kalitesi ve öğrenci memnuniyetini bir arada değerlendiren araştırmalara görsel haritalama ve bibliyometrik analiz yöntemi ile bütüncül bir bakış açısı sunmayı amaçlamaktadır. Bu amaçla Web of Science veri tabanında 119 çalışma belirlenmiş ve VOSviewer programı ile analiz edilmiştir. Araştırma sonucunda çoğu Asya ülkelerinden ve eğitim araştırmaları kategorisinde olmak üzere 47 ülkeden bilim insanının çalışma yaptığı belirlenmiştir. Ayrıca çalışmaların çeşitli hizmet kalitesi ölçekleri kullanılarak anket yöntemiyle yürütüldüğü gözlemlenmiştir. Özellikle 2021 yılında yapılan araştırma sayısının toplam bilimsel üretimin yaklaşık %20’sini temsil ettiği, trendin devam etmesi halinde önümüzdeki yıllarda da artmaya devam edeceği söylenebilir.

Service Quality and Student Satisfaction in Higher Education: Bibliometric Analysis with Visual Mapping Technique

Service quality research in higher education continues to maintain continuity due to developing technology, changing environments and student profiles. Therefore, student satisfaction has become one of the most important goals of higher education institutions. For this reason, the study aims to provide a holistic view of the research that evaluates service quality and student satisfaction in higher education worldwide with visual mapping and bibliometric analysis methods. For this purpose, 119 studies were identified in the Web of Science database and analyzed with the VOSviewer program. As a result, it was determined that scientists from 47 countries, mainly from Asian countries and in educational research, conducted a study. In addition, it has been observed that the studies were carried out by questionnaire method using various service quality scales. Therefore, it can be said that the number of studies carried out primarily in 2021 represents approximately 20% of the total scientific production. If the trend continues, it will increase in the coming years.
